Webexample of hay dryness, an "as is" yield of 4.0 tons per acre is equal to 3.4 "dry" tons per acre when the moisture is 15%. [4.0 tons x (100% - 15% moisture)] = 3.4 tons of dry forage]. WebDivide the value of the land by the size of the land in acres. The result is the value of the land per acre.
